Significant Insider Sales
- Fritz Prinz, a key director at QuantumScape, recently parted ways with a hefty 1M shares, pocketing over $15M.
- Another director, Jeffrey B. Straubel, sold more than 157,000 shares fetching close to $2.7M, retaining a modest number of shares post-sale.
- Brad W. Buss, yet another influential director, offloaded 300,000 stocks, grossing approximately $5.4M after the transaction.
- An insider known as Srinivasan Sivaram exited 120,000 shares, a move valued at over $2M, sparking questions about internal sentiments.
- Overall, the company has witnessed a chain of significant insider sell-offs. Such moves often raise eyebrows concerning internal confidence levels.

The current wave of insider sales aligns curiously with the company’s recent financial disclosures. QuantumScape’s latest earnings report reveals a tale of mounting expenses and ongoing strategic investments. With a loss of over $105M from continuing operations last quarter, the company is trekking through challenging terrains. Despite this loss, QuantumScape managed to report robust cash reserves, sitting at a comfortable $822M by the end of the reported period.
Delving deeper into QuantumScape’s key financial metrics, a mixed picture emerges. Their enterprise is valued at a notable $7.87B, while their price-to-book ratio standing at 7.87 hints towards market overvaluation when compared to tangible assets. Their cash flow from ongoing investments is in the negative zone at over $156M majorly due to investments in short-term securities. Despite capital infusion, operational efficiency, reflected in negative Return on Assets (ROA) and Return on Equity (ROE), underscores systemic inefficiencies. Yet, an impressive current ratio exceeding 21 ensures that QuantumScape can handle short-term liabilities convincingly if needed.
Analyzing Insider Moves: Implications for Market Dynamics
The string of insider stock sales at QuantumScape paints a multifaceted picture of the internal and external market sentiments. Typically, investors interpret heavy selling by insiders as a lack of conviction in the company’s near-term trajectory or valuations. This influx of insider trades hints that market confidence, at least from those within QuantumScape, stands on shaky ground.
This selling coincides with a notable drop in the stock’s performance recently. Out of the last few trading days, QuantumScape has observed a consistent decline punctuated by brief recoveries, echoing a turbulent trading environment. The stock closed at $13.745 with a volatility witness firsthand, oscillating between highs of $17.71 and lows touching $13.09 in the past two weeks.
For a company that has hinged its growth story on promising breakthroughs in solid-state battery technology, any disruption in internal confidence as perceived through insider sales may substantially impact market positioning and future stock performance.
